🌸🌸重点写在前面——注意docker本机地址请使用host.docker.internal🌸🌸由于macOS的docker底层实现的不同,主要原因是macOS的docker在容器和宿主之间无法通过ip直接通信。因此在安装的时候需要特殊注意与ip相关的设置,当容器需要访问宿主ip时,需要使用docker.for.mac.host.internal或者host.docker.internal代替。这里向zookeeper注册的时候,使用的是host.docker.internal,我们在程序中连接kafka的时候,直接使用localhost会报错,如:Errorconnectingtonodeho
文章目录一、生成相关证书二、配置elasticSearh三、配置kibana四、配置logstash五、配置filebeat六、连接httpses的javaapi一、生成相关证书ps:主节点操作切换用户:sues进入目录:cd/home/es/elasticsearch-7.6.2创建文件:viinstances.ymlinstances:-name:"master"ip:-"192.168.248.10"-name:"slave1"ip:-"192.168.248.11"-name:"slave2"ip:-"192.168.248.12"-name:"kibana"ip:-"192.168.
一、安装elasticsearch创建es-network,让es、kibana在同一个网段:dockernetworkcreate--driver=bridge--subnet=192.168.1.10/24es-network运行elasticsearchdockerrun-d\--nameelasticsearch\#容器名--hostnameelasticsearch#主机名--network=es-network\#es网络,可以连通kibana--ip=192.168.1.10\#静态ip-eES_JAVA_OPTS="-Xms512m-Xmx512m"\#指定内存大小-e"dis
一、概述在 Kubernetes(K8s)上运行 Elasticsearch 是一种在容器化环境中部署和管理 Elasticsearch 集群的常见方法。Elasticsearch 是一款流行的分布式搜索和分析引擎,而 Kubernetes 则提供了一个出色的平台,用于编排容器并管理Elasticsearch的可伸缩性和容错性。以下是在 Kubernetes 上部署 Elasticsearch 的一般步骤:安装Kubernetes集群:确保你已经运行起了Kubernetes集群。你可以使用托管的Kubernetes服务,如GoogleKubernetesEngine(GKE)、AmazonEl
docker安装elasticsearch、kibana(可视化管理elasticsearch)dockerpullelasticsearch:7.12.1dockerpullkibana:7.12.1 创建docker自定义网络docker自定义网络可以使得容器之间使用容器名网络互连,默认的网络不会有这功能。一定要配置自定义网络,并将两个容器同时加到网络中,否则下面的http://es:9200会无法访问到esdockernetworkcreatees-net 启动elasticsearch、kibana容器启动elasticsearch容器dockerrun-d\ --namees\-e"
Elasticsearch安装首先在官网下载一下ES的压缩包:(我是m1的各位自己看着下)DownloadElasticsearch|Elastic jdk,要有的!不会自自己百度一下最好1.8的(你环境变设成全局的)放在哪里不重要,修改配置文件,免登录直接解压然后启动,启动好端口9200.我们打开浏览器,输入域名http://localhost:9200/,可以看到: 启动好了:我们就要使用它啊,当然有工具去做可视化。kibana的安装有云直接上brewtapelastic/tapbrewinstallelastic/tap/kibana-full没有直接下附官网地址:https://ww
ELK实例----使用filebeat收集tomcat日志到ES并利用kibana展示1.0环境拓扑图1.1环境准备1.2安装1.2.1安装elasticsearch1.2.2安装Kibana1.2.3安装metricbeat1.2.3安装filebeat1.2.4安装Nginx1.2.5安装tomcat1.3修改Filebeat配置文件1.4测试1.4.1head插件查看1.4.2Kibana插件查看1.4.2.1手动将模拟的成功数据插入tomcat日志中1.4.2.1手动将模拟的失败数据插入tomcat日志中1.5收集nginx日志到ES并利用kibana展示1.6收集nginx日志到Re
基于之前的文章,精简操作而来让ELK在同一个docker网络下通过名字直接访问Ubuntu服务器ELK部署与实践使用Docker部署canal服务实现MySQL和ES实时同步Docker部署ES服务,canal全量同步的时候内存爆炸,ES/CanalAdapter自动关闭,CPU100%1.拉镜像dockerpullelasticsearch:7.8.0dockerpullkibana:7.8.0dockerpullcanal/canal-server:v1.1.4dockerpullslpcat/canal-adapter:v1.1.5-jdk8dockerpullmysql:5.72.my
本文介绍了从dockercompose搭建elasticsearch并安装IK分词插件,然后再用kibana测试的详细步骤。利用dockercompose搭建elasticsearch和kibana1.下载软件1.1下载镜像dockerpullelasticsearch:7.17.1dockerpullkibana:7.17.11.2下载IK分词插件从官方网站Releases·medcl/elasticsearch-analysis-ik·GitHub下载对应版本的分词插件,因为我们的elasticsearch为7.17.1所以下载elasticsearch-analysis-ik-7.17.
Docker下Jaeger部署文档近来在学习到Jaeger链路追踪的时候,顺带学习了一下如何去部署Jaeger在服务器上关于JaegerJaeger受到Dapper和OpenZipkin的启发,是由UberTechnologies作为开源发布的分布式跟踪系统。它用于监控和故障排除基于微服务的分布式系统,包括:分布式上下文传播分布式事务监控根本原因分析服务依赖分析性能/延迟优化技术规格Go中实现的后端组件React/Javascript用户界面支持的存储后端:Cassandra3.4+Elasticsearch5.x,6.x,7.xKafka内存存储经过认证的grpc插件:带有Promscale